Factoring is the sale of your accounts receivable (invoices) to a funding source at a discount off the face value in return for immediate cash. The funding source is known as a factor. This is also commonly known as account receivable factoring or invoice factoring.

The process typically works like this: You deliver a product or service and issue an invoice to your customer. Without invoice factoring, you wait 30,60, or 90 days for payment. With accounts receivable factoring, the factor immediately purchases the invoice and advances an initial payment of 70-95 percent of the invoiced amount. In most cases, you'll have funds in your account within 24 hours. When your customer pays the invoice (payment is made directly to the factor), you'll receive the remaining balance (5 to 30 percent of the invoice amount) less the factor's fee.

Typical factoring clients include manufacturers, wholesalers, distributors, and service businesses who have the following:

  • $500,000 to $50 million in annual sales
     
  • Customers that are credit worthy risks
     
  • Invoices that are verifiable.
     
  • Good management & industry knowledge
